WPL : Jafar Rahama wins NASCO MVP Award in Northern Ladies Drawn Match with Prisons Ladies in Sunyani

Northern Ladies Fc played Prisons Ladies Fc at Corronation Park in Sunyani on Saturday, 30th January, 2021. The match was the third match for either side. The two teams shared the spoil after the match ended 1 all.

The Black Princesses winger, Jafar Rahama was adjudged the NASCO Most Valuable Player of the Match after performing very well for her side, Northern Ladies Fc. Her performance made the match a very interesting one. The winger is known best for her pace on the flanks and her ability to dribble pass the opponents. She was successful in almost all her attempted dribbles, creating several scoring chances. Unfortunately only one could be converted to a goal which was scored by Torkodzo Fredrica on the 20th minute.

The young female attacker won the NASCO MVP award twice last season before the season was truncated as a result of the Covid-19 pandemic which led to all sporting activities to be put on hold until October, 2020.

Northern Ladies Fc will play their city rivals, Pearlpia Ladies Fc on Friday, 5th February, 2021 at Aliu Mahama Stadium. A must watch derby match to all football fans.
